Company Profile
A specialist Engineering Consultancy, leading the way in Fire Safety Services in the built environment.
They are dedicated to providing full spectrum, lifecycle fire engineering services for building projects, from feasibility to occupation and beyond.
They deliver pragmatic solutions, innovative designs, and comprehensive advice.
This includes fire safety strategy design, fire engineering analysis, fire safety audit, external wall fire safety, risk assessment and building safety case services.

The primary service delivery of the Fire Engineering Division is as follows:

  • Fire Safety Strategy Design & Development (Fire Strategy, Fire Statement, etc.)
  • External Wall Fire Safety (FRAEW, Remediation, etc.)
  • Fire Engineering Analysis & Assessment (CFD, Evacuation Modelling, etc.)
  • Expert Services (Advisory, Witness, etc.)
  • Fire Safety Audits
  • Peer Review
  • Safety Case


Skills & Attributes:

  • Qualification to at least Level 6 (BEng or BSc)
  • Strong experience working with fire standards including but not limited to BS9999, BS9991, BS7974, etc.
  • Understanding of current and upcoming fire safety legislation and guidance in the UK
  • Strong technical delivery capability including a strong record of successfully delivered fire strategies
  • Strong experience leading and managing complex projects
  • Membership of IFE or equivalent
  • Achieved or ability to work towards chartered fire engineer
  • Experience with business development and building client relationships
  • Pro-active and ambitious mindset
  • Experience with line management and development of team members
  • Experience with CFD modelling would be preferable
